Output 89de35f30e1f5441a402243188d616e26b5bb961254ea080d9f3e6f2077c9e9c:1

value
53706528
script pubkey
OP_0 OP_PUSHBYTES_32 f6f2b1c8c761cfcc1bb1506435676b4eb9787b5d2bfb7ecd61e6d9063e3616ea
address
bc1q7metrjx8v88ucxa32pjr2emtf6uhs76a90ahantpumvsv03kzm4qp46ez2
transaction
89de35f30e1f5441a402243188d616e26b5bb961254ea080d9f3e6f2077c9e9c
spent
true